Change Your World 2009

Make A Pledge For The Planet

22nd June 2009

Thousands of people across the UK are about to make a pledge to change their world by changing the way they travel.

Sustrans' Change Your World campaign is asking you to visit www.changeyourworld.org.uk and promise to swap just one car journey between 29 June and 4 July in favour of walking, cycling, taking public transport, car-sharing or simply not making the trip at all! This is the week to join with thousands of others and Change Your World.

Amazingly, if we all take this one small action together car traffic will reduce by ten per cent, giving us healthier journeys, cleaner air and quieter streets.

If everyone in Britain made one less car journey every week it would reduce car travel by at least ten per cent, which would mean an annual saving of almost 7 million tonnes of carbon dioxide.

This would be a significant step towards achieving Britain’s target to reduce emissions to at least 34 per cent below 1990 emissions by 2018-22, set by the Chancellor in April as part of the World’s first carbon budget.
